We’re on the lookout for a Brand Manager to help shape, launch and elevate our biggest brand moments across PizzaExpress and Milano. Reporting into our Senior Brand Manager, you’ll lead bold, integrated national campaigns that drive frequency, fame and commercial impact – from idea to execution (and everything after). This is a role for someone who loves great ideas, thinks commercially, thrives on collaboration and wants to make work that people notice.

What you’ll be doing

  • You’ll create standout, through‑the‑line campaigns that keep PizzaExpress front of mind across the UK & Ireland – building brand fame, relevance and results.
  • Own and co‑manage our brand calendar, shaping campaign planning, creative wrappers, content and post‑campaign analysis.
  • Develop ATL promotional campaigns, from brief to creative to media planning.
  • Build campaign toolkits that land brilliantly across the business.
  • Lead end‑to‑end loyalty campaigns, working closely with CRM, Trading and Insight teams to deliver personalised, behaviour‑driving comms.
  • Develop and deliver strategic partnerships (think Tesco, Avios, Blue Light Card, Ello Group) alongside our Trading team.
  • Bring campaigns to life in restaurant through POS and internal touchpoints – A‑boards, table talkers, windows and more.
  • Work hand in hand with Performance Marketing, CRM, PR and Social to make sure every campaign shows up strong across all channels.
  • Brief and shape photoshoots and creative assets, working closely with our Creative & Content Studio on art direction.
  • Lead and develop our Marketing Executive, supporting local restaurant marketing, new openings and refurbs.
